摘要
We demonstrate a BODIPY-based small molecule photopatterned surface by thiol-ene click chemistry at room temperature utilizing only 366 nm UV light. The resulting cross-linked polymer exhibits porous surfaces according to AFM and TEM results. A dramatic blue shift occurred in absorption spectra and the photoluminescence was also intensified as a result of crosslinking. Optical and electrochemical results are compatible with the DFT calculations. The obtained results prove that the photopatterned BODIPY-based material can be easily and inexpensively applied in multilayer optoelectronic devices.
